Is there a direct bus between Walsall and Wakefield?

No, there is no direct bus from Walsall station to Wakefield station. However, there are services departing from Walsall Bus Station and arriving at Bus Station stand 21 via Birmingham and Bus Stn.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 5h 54m.

Is there a direct train between Walsall and Wakefield?

No, there is no direct train from Walsall to Wakefield. However, there are services departing from Walsall and arriving at Wakefield Westgate via Birmingham New Street.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 55m.
